World’s Largest National Flag Made Of Jelly

80 students from the Imperial College Singapore Society in London created the world’s largest jelly mosaic out of 16,125 box-sized jelly pieces in the shape of the Singapore flag on the university lawn on 21 Feb 2004. The record jelly mosaic measured 12.8m by 19.8m and was named Flag-Gel-Lah as part of ICSS’s aim to create a record-size Singapore flag (Flag), that gels the Singaporean community (Gel) and introduces the Singapore slang, culture and dessert to the world (Lah).
